Chambers in which the process of disinfection of things by the steam-air or steam-formalin method occurs are called steam-formalin. The active reagents here are steam, formaldehyde and air.

In the process of disinfection, formalin is neutralized in the steam-formalin chamber. Formaldehyde, which is adsorbed on the surface of things, penetrates into tissues due to steam, after which it dissolves in condensate and turns into formalin. In such chambers, disinfection can be carried out at lower temperatures (up to + 59 Β° C), but the humidity should be at least 80%.

Steam is supplied to the chambers from below. In such devices, things that can go bad at high temperatures can be disinfected. It can be shoes, leather goods, furs or rubber things. Also in the cells you can disinfect linen (pillows, mattresses, things made of silk, oilcloth, velvet or nylon).

Disinfection is an important process for various medical and government agencies. This applies not only to instruments used in surgical procedures, but also to things. In addition, disinfection is required for archival documents, books, medical clothing and bedding. Since after each patient everything should not only be washed, but also disinfected.

For disinfection, steam-formalin chambers are used. They are used in medical and preventive institutions, in spas and hotel complexes. That is, in those places where there is a constant flow of people who need to guarantee not only cleanliness, but also safety.

The process of disinfecting things in such chambers can be carried out manually or semi-automatically. The design, as a rule, is made of stainless steel and has a long service life.

The steam-formalin disinfection chamber, operating on a steam-formalin mixture, allows disinfection at lower temperatures. It is used for those things that do not withstand thermal sterilization. In some medical institutions it is used for the treatment of contaminated instruments and their further storage.

The design of the camera consists of:

  • two doors (one for loading, the second for unloading), which ensure tightness;
  • shelves on which it is convenient to place objects;
  • heating device, which is located below;
  • protective grill.

In the upper plane of the heater there are ditches where formaldehyde solution is poured. A psychrometer and a thermometer are specially built in to control the entire process.

Advantages of the steam-formalin chamber:

  • safety in compliance with norms and rules;
  • tightness;
  • the device is suitable for both disinfection and storage;
  • high power sterilizing agent;
  • ease of use (only one person can serve the camera).

Depending on the required technical parameters of the chamber working on formaldehyde, it can differ in volume, number of shelves inside, dimensions (portable or stationary models), sterilization time (within 24 hours) and the required amount of paraformaldehyde (about 10 g per sterilization process) .

It is important not to place such cameras in direct sunlight and in rooms without ventilation.

For the disinfection process, steam-formalin chambers of different sizes are used. Their volume depends on the needs of the institution and can vary from 1.4 to 10 m 3 . Steam supply to the structure from a centralized source of steam or an autonomous steam boiler.

The nozzle connected to the rubber hose is designed to spray formalin in the upper part of the structure. At the bottom of the clean compartment there are special ventilation openings and an exhaust pipe. Here is a steam ejector or fan that connects to the motor. A pressure gauge is installed on the steam line to control temperature and humidity - two thermometers (dry and wet).

On the floor are steam-formalin pipes through which the structure is filled. Underneath are heating batteries. The heating surface is small so that the temperature and humidity are not disturbed. A safety grille is installed above the pipes, and openings on the floor for the exit of condensate. The latest camera models have special retractable trolleys for ease of use. The camera is controlled by the unloading compartment.

For the first time, such a decontamination chamber was used by Japanese doctors during the war at the beginning of the 20th century. Here, the influence of five factors was used: humidity, temperature, formalin, the time of their exposure and vortex movements inside the structure. The last condition was necessary for the heat to be distributed evenly and penetrate through all things. Initially, devices were used for a variety of things, while in large quantities. For example, in chambers 30 m 3 in size, up to 500 working sets per day can be disinfected.
